    Only coffee for me.

    One thing to keep in mind is that coffee is consumed in far larger quantities worldwide compared to tea. Per capita consumption of coffee starts at 12 kg (Finland) and doesn't drop down below 1 kg until 81st place Morocco.

    Tea, on the other hand starts at 7.54 kg (Turkey) and drops below 1 kg at 24th place Japan.
